Glutathione: effective % & pH 글루타치온

⏱ 1 min read
Quick answer: Glutathione: effective concentration no standardised topical concentration exists, optimal pH 5.0–7.0, evidence Limited. Harmless in a serum, unlikely to do much. Injections and drips are a medical decision with genuine safety questions — talk to a doctor, not a clinic salesperson.

How much Glutathione actually works? Here's the dosage, pH and evidence — the formulator-level read behind the % on a Korean label.

Effective %no standardised topical concentration exists
Optimal pH5.0–7.0
EvidenceLimited
Onsetunclear — topical evidence does not support a reliable timeline

What the % on the label really means

Harmless in a serum, unlikely to do much. Injections and drips are a medical decision with genuine safety questions — talk to a doctor, not a clinic salesperson.

⚠️ Ceiling: It oxidises readily and penetrates poorly, so a higher listed percentage does not translate into more reaching skin.
